HACC vs. Johnson

Both Harrisburg Area Community College and Johnson College are 2-4 years schools located in Pennsylvania. The following statements compare Harrisburg Area Community College and Johnson College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Johnson's tuition ($21,225) is more expensive than HACC ($12,472).

  • Johnson's students to faculty ratio (12 to 1) is lower than HACC (13 to 1).
  • HACC (12,585 students) is larger than Johnson (678 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Johnson ($8,720) has higher amount of financial aid than HACC ($5,186).
  • Johnson's graduation rate (55%) is higher than HACC (21%).
